Abstract

Official abstract text for this publication.

An antenna apparatus includes: an antenna module having a radiation-oriented surface in a first direction to transmit and receive a radio signal; and a radio-wave reinforcement member arranged in a second direction opposite to the first direction within a preset distance from the antenna module to amplify radiation performance of the antenna module, and including an electric conductor having a curved surface concave to the antenna module.

First claim

Opening claim text (preview).

The invention claimed is: 1. An antenna apparatus comprising: an antenna module having a front surface which is a radiation-oriented surface, and a back surface opposite the front surface, and a plurality of antenna devices spaced apart from each other on the front surface so as to form a phased-array antenna to transmit and receive radio signals; and a radio-wave reinforcement member including an electric conductor having a concave surface with a center that is positioned behind the back surface so as to be behind the antenna module by a preset distance and that faces toward the antenna module, to amplify radiation performance of the phased-array antenna. 2. The antenna apparatus according to claim 1 , wherein the preset distance does not exceed a focal distance of the concave surface. 3. The antenna apparatus according to claim 1 , wherein the preset distance corresponds to a radiation length of the antenna module and a wavelength corresponding to an operation frequency of the antenna module. 4. The antenna apparatus according to claim 1 , wherein the antenna module is provided to transmit and receive the radio signals based on a millimeter wave. 5. The antenna apparatus according to claim 1 , further comprising a control circuit configured to individually adjust a phase of a voltage applied to the plurality of antenna devices. 6. The antenna apparatus according to claim 1 , wherein the radio-wave reinforcement member further includes at least one additional electric conductor, each electric conductor of the at least one additional electric conductor having a concave surface with a center that is positioned behind the back surface so as to be behind the antenna module by a preset distance and that faces toward the antenna module, to amplify radiation performance of the phrased-array antenna, where each electric conductor of the electric conductor and the at least one additional electric conductor has a different curvature from each other. 7. The antenna apparatus according to claim 6 , wherein the concave surfaces of each electric conductor of the electric conductor and the at least one additional electric conductor have different central axial lines with respect to the antenna module. 8. The antenna apparatus according to claim 6 , wherein the radio-wave reinforcement member comprises a base comprising a dielectric, wherein the electric conductor and the at least one additional electric conductor include a first electric conductor formed on a front surface of the base facing the antenna module and having a first curvature, and a second electric conductor formed on a back surface of the base opposite to the front surface of the base and having a second curvature.
